PER CURIAM.

Defendant was convicted, by the court sitting without a jury, of armed robbery, MCL 750.529; MSA 28.797, and felony-firearm, MCL 750.227b; MSA 28.424(2). He was sentenced to terms of imprisonment of from 4-1/2 to 10 years and 2 years respectively. Defendant now appeals as of right and contends that error occurred in the admission into evidence of testimony regarding another uncharged offense. We disagree and affirm.
